"Us Financiers" Magazine 

For decades, Muskoka, a large lakeland area north of Toronto, has been host to celebrity industrialists and financiers. -The New York Times, 9/16/05


Chip and Muffy: Happier than Ever!
When Farnsworth J. "Chip" Farmington III manned an Excel spreadsheet electronically linked to his hot Wall Street brokerage on Sept. 7, his fiancée Muffy Wigglesworth got the party started by comparing portfolios with pals. "Chip and Muffy sat right next to each other," said an onlooker, "and they couldn't be cuter, eh."

Check On!
It's been four years since legendary law partners Andrews Lewis IV, C. Brewster Addison, Lyford Burroughs, and Forster Charles Hadley, jr., appeared together in court, but on Sept. 14, they reunited in Muskoka. The reason? To watch a Maple Leafs preseason game on CBC! "Looks like they need to skate more to the left," Hadley quipped to our on-the-scene reporter.

Celebrity Feuds of the Week!
Nathaniel Larrabee, founder of Larrabee Tool & Die, vs. corporate raider Phelan Gillespie. Last year Gillespie paid Larrabee $34 billion for LT&D, then promptly fired all the employees and turned the company into a online-porn mega-warehouse. The furious Larrabee says their contract specifically prohibited Gillspie from jet-skiing too close to Larrabee's favorite Muskoka fishing holes.
Our verdict: Gillespie! Money talks, Nate! Can't you use some of that $34 billion to buy some Mrs. Pauls?
